libpayload: Swap the macros of VT100_CURSOR_ON and VT100_CURSOR_OFF
The macros of VT100_CURSOR_ON and VT100_CURSOR_OFF are exchanged

@@ -171,8 +171,8 @@ int serial_getchar(void)
#define VT100_SREVERSE "\e[7m"
#define VT100_EREVERSE "\e[m"
#define VT100_CURSOR_ADDR "\e[%d;%dH"
-#define VT100_CURSOR_ON "\e[?25l"
-#define VT100_CURSOR_OFF "\e[?25h"
+#define VT100_CURSOR_ON "\e[?25h"
+#define VT100_CURSOR_OFF "\e[?25l"
/* The following smacs/rmacs are actually for xterm; a real vt100 has
enacs=\E(B\E)0, smacs=^N, rmacs=^O. */
#define VT100_SMACS "\e(0"
